Our active period of weather has ended, leaving behind patchy fog and calm conditions this morning. The cold frontal passage will return our high temperatures towards the low 80s today and tomorrow, giving our area a brief reprieve from the hot and humid weather with sunny skies overhead. Lows fall back into the upper 50s tonight with mostly clear skies tonight, a byproduct of diurnal heating. Expect partly cloudy skies tomorrow to give way to mostly sunny conditions on Father's Day alongside a substantial warmup into the low 90s. A heatwave will likely take hold of Michiana from Sunday onward into at least the first half of the week with heat indices right around 100F expected Monday and Tuesday as hot and humid conditions continue to build.
Today: Sunny. High 82.
Tonight: Mostly clear. Low 57.
Saturday: Partly cloudy. High 83.
Sunday (Father's Day): Mostly sunny. High 92.
